龔建新 王代遠(yuǎn)
【摘要】? ? 在網(wǎng)絡(luò)教學(xué)不斷發(fā)展的今天,教學(xué)資源平臺(tái)建設(shè)在高職院校教學(xué)中的地位得到很大的提升。由于學(xué)校網(wǎng)絡(luò)構(gòu)架設(shè)定的不當(dāng),在訪問教學(xué)資源時(shí),時(shí)常出現(xiàn)資源傳輸誤碼率較高的問題,影響學(xué)校的師生正常訪問。針對(duì)此問題,本文設(shè)計(jì)采用混合P2P網(wǎng)絡(luò)技術(shù)的解決在高職院校園建設(shè)教學(xué)資源平臺(tái)中網(wǎng)絡(luò)傳輸中的問題,同時(shí)根據(jù)高職院校網(wǎng)絡(luò)教學(xué)的特點(diǎn),采用自頂向下的方式構(gòu)建教學(xué)資源平臺(tái),并對(duì)元數(shù)據(jù)展開處理。采用P2P技術(shù)對(duì)校園網(wǎng)網(wǎng)絡(luò)構(gòu)架展開優(yōu)化,設(shè)定集中式P2P結(jié)構(gòu)作為校園網(wǎng)網(wǎng)絡(luò)結(jié)構(gòu),實(shí)現(xiàn)點(diǎn)對(duì)點(diǎn)的資源傳輸。通過構(gòu)建實(shí)驗(yàn)分析環(huán)節(jié),與其他兩種方法對(duì)比分析,此方法的教學(xué)資源傳輸誤碼率較低且平均時(shí)延較短。由此可知,在校園網(wǎng)建設(shè)中采用混合P2P網(wǎng)絡(luò),可有效提升資源庫的資料傳輸能力。
【關(guān)鍵詞】? ? 混合P2P網(wǎng)絡(luò)? ? 流媒體? ? 教學(xué)資料庫? ? 數(shù)據(jù)庫
引言:
隨著互聯(lián)網(wǎng)技術(shù)的不斷發(fā)展,網(wǎng)絡(luò)的影響也在不斷蔓延,并快速的改變了人們的思維、工作以及生活方式。伴隨著計(jì)算機(jī)處理能力的提升與網(wǎng)絡(luò)的普及與升級(jí),人們不再滿足于網(wǎng)頁瀏覽,下載,聊天,等等休閑方式,而是將其應(yīng)用于工作與教學(xué)之中,網(wǎng)絡(luò)教學(xué)將成為未來網(wǎng)絡(luò)應(yīng)用的新方向[1-2]。在網(wǎng)絡(luò)教學(xué)開展的過程中,教學(xué)資源平臺(tái)是主導(dǎo)教學(xué)過程的重要內(nèi)容。
但目前教育界對(duì)于網(wǎng)絡(luò)教學(xué)資源平臺(tái)并沒有明確的界定,通過文獻(xiàn)研究只能找到零星的描述。對(duì)眾多描述語句進(jìn)行分析可初步了解到,網(wǎng)絡(luò)教學(xué)資源庫構(gòu)建的基本目標(biāo)是為網(wǎng)絡(luò)教學(xué)過程服務(wù),使用其為教師或是學(xué)生提供最有效的支持性服務(wù)。此資源平臺(tái)具有多媒體性,其主要組成部分由多種媒體素材組成,并具有多種表示方式[3]。此資源平臺(tái)一般包含多媒體素材庫、課件教案庫、案例庫及試題庫等幾大部分。對(duì)其功能方面進(jìn)行研究可知,此教學(xué)資源平臺(tái)可為教學(xué)過程提供便利的管理方法與應(yīng)用方式。因此,構(gòu)建采用混合P2P網(wǎng)絡(luò)技術(shù)的教學(xué)資源平臺(tái)。此外,為了便于數(shù)據(jù)資源的傳輸與共享,在高職院校資源平臺(tái)構(gòu)建的過程中需要具有一定的規(guī)范與標(biāo)準(zhǔn)。
一、基于混合P2P網(wǎng)絡(luò)的教學(xué)資源平臺(tái)設(shè)計(jì)
在以往的高職院校資源平臺(tái)構(gòu)建中,由于構(gòu)建方法選擇的不當(dāng),教學(xué)資源平臺(tái)的數(shù)據(jù)傳輸能力較差,因此,在此次設(shè)計(jì)中使用混合P2P網(wǎng)絡(luò)優(yōu)化原有設(shè)計(jì)過程。近年來出現(xiàn)的P2P技術(shù)可以合理使用網(wǎng)絡(luò)的一些免費(fèi)資源,在資源平臺(tái)設(shè)計(jì)過程中,可適當(dāng)?shù)氖褂昧髅襟w,提升教學(xué)資源平臺(tái)的數(shù)據(jù)傳輸能力[4-5]。
1.1構(gòu)建教學(xué)資源倉庫
在教學(xué)資源平臺(tái)中,需要數(shù)據(jù)倉庫和數(shù)據(jù)集保證資源平臺(tái)的正常使用。通常數(shù)據(jù)倉庫的建設(shè)方式有以下兩種:一種是自頂向下的方式;另一種是自底向上的方式。在此次設(shè)計(jì)中,根據(jù)網(wǎng)絡(luò)教學(xué)的特點(diǎn),采用自頂向下的方式,即首先建立全局?jǐn)?shù)據(jù)倉庫。
通過在全局?jǐn)?shù)據(jù)倉庫中抽取教學(xué)資料建立部門級(jí)教學(xué)資料倉庫的形式,完成教學(xué)的存儲(chǔ)與提取。由于數(shù)據(jù)倉庫中的數(shù)據(jù)在使用前已經(jīng)進(jìn)行了轉(zhuǎn)換和清洗,教學(xué)資源信息質(zhì)量較高,以此建立資源集市較為容易,且易于保證教學(xué)資料信息形式的一致性。此種方式在規(guī)劃和設(shè)計(jì)良好的情況下,資料庫可長(zhǎng)期發(fā)揮作用,具有較強(qiáng)的靈活性。
為保證資源平臺(tái)的使用效果,對(duì)數(shù)據(jù)倉庫中的元數(shù)據(jù)展開處理。元數(shù)據(jù)是教學(xué)中使用資源的數(shù)據(jù)源,也是教學(xué)資源平臺(tái)的應(yīng)用靈魂[6]。在元數(shù)據(jù)管理的過程中,將數(shù)據(jù)的初始處理過程設(shè)定為抽取、創(chuàng)建、存儲(chǔ)、更新、導(dǎo)航和使用等方式,并對(duì)數(shù)據(jù)進(jìn)行詳細(xì)的描寫與說明,其中需要描述的主要內(nèi)容包含數(shù)據(jù)的上下級(jí)關(guān)系,每條資源的現(xiàn)實(shí)意義以及數(shù)據(jù)之間的關(guān)系,通過此設(shè)定對(duì)教學(xué)資源平臺(tái)的數(shù)據(jù)來源與數(shù)據(jù)管理形式進(jìn)行優(yōu)化。
1.2網(wǎng)絡(luò)架構(gòu)設(shè)計(jì)
在此次設(shè)計(jì)中,采用P2P軟件對(duì)網(wǎng)絡(luò)構(gòu)架展開優(yōu)化。通過研究可知,P2P軟件有各種各樣的種類,根據(jù)網(wǎng)絡(luò)教學(xué)的需求,選定細(xì)小的應(yīng)用程序作為網(wǎng)絡(luò)構(gòu)架優(yōu)化的主要工具。設(shè)定集中式P2P結(jié)構(gòu)作為資源平臺(tái)網(wǎng)絡(luò)結(jié)構(gòu),在網(wǎng)絡(luò)中設(shè)定服務(wù)器和客戶端,在服務(wù)器中預(yù)先設(shè)定與其相關(guān)節(jié)點(diǎn)名稱索引與共享資源信息內(nèi)容。當(dāng)節(jié)點(diǎn)處于通信狀態(tài)時(shí),通過服務(wù)器對(duì)其進(jìn)行控制[7]。將教學(xué)資源平臺(tái)中的網(wǎng)絡(luò)形式設(shè)定為點(diǎn)對(duì)點(diǎn)的形式,在資源平臺(tái)運(yùn)行時(shí)間中必須有和它對(duì)應(yīng)的節(jié)點(diǎn)進(jìn)行交互,點(diǎn)對(duì)點(diǎn)配置可使教學(xué)資源平臺(tái)擴(kuò)展到有更多的大的網(wǎng)絡(luò)。
網(wǎng)絡(luò)節(jié)點(diǎn)設(shè)定為P2P網(wǎng)絡(luò)架構(gòu)節(jié)點(diǎn)后,在每個(gè)用戶節(jié)點(diǎn)設(shè)定所用地址靜態(tài)配置文件,實(shí)現(xiàn)對(duì)信息傳輸對(duì)應(yīng)點(diǎn)的預(yù)測(cè),并控制與之交換的對(duì)應(yīng)列表,完成網(wǎng)絡(luò)外部的攻擊守護(hù),保證網(wǎng)絡(luò)數(shù)據(jù)傳輸?shù)陌踩?。資料收發(fā)人的接收器信息采用單獨(dú)的副本信息實(shí)現(xiàn)網(wǎng)絡(luò)服務(wù),并將資料庫的RTP設(shè)定為獨(dú)立的反網(wǎng)絡(luò)協(xié)議層,采用UDP作為傳輸層,實(shí)現(xiàn)教學(xué)資源傳輸[8]。
將上述設(shè)定的兩部分進(jìn)行有序融合,完成基于混合P2P網(wǎng)絡(luò)的教學(xué)資料庫設(shè)計(jì)。
二、實(shí)驗(yàn)對(duì)比分析
2.1 實(shí)驗(yàn)環(huán)境設(shè)定
在此次實(shí)驗(yàn)中,使用傳統(tǒng)的教學(xué)資源平臺(tái)構(gòu)建方法與文中設(shè)計(jì)的資料庫構(gòu)建方法進(jìn)行對(duì)比。為控制兩類方法在對(duì)比中的使用效果,構(gòu)建相應(yīng)的實(shí)驗(yàn)平臺(tái),具體實(shí)驗(yàn)平臺(tái)運(yùn)行參數(shù)如下所示。
采用上表中內(nèi)容組裝此次實(shí)驗(yàn)過程中使用的實(shí)驗(yàn)平臺(tái),并在此環(huán)境中完成傳統(tǒng)資源平臺(tái)設(shè)計(jì)方法與文中設(shè)計(jì)資源平臺(tái)設(shè)計(jì)方法的對(duì)比。
2.2 實(shí)驗(yàn)過程設(shè)定
在工作日的12:00到15:00時(shí)間內(nèi),由資源平臺(tái)服務(wù)器隨機(jī)向網(wǎng)絡(luò)教學(xué)終端發(fā)送3000條指令,統(tǒng)計(jì)服務(wù)器接收到網(wǎng)絡(luò)教學(xué)終端放回的教學(xué)要求的數(shù)據(jù)信息的數(shù)量。
為提升實(shí)驗(yàn)結(jié)果的代表性與對(duì)比性,在3600bps、7200bps、14400bps進(jìn)行資料傳輸測(cè)試,每種傳輸速度進(jìn)行兩次測(cè)試,完成文中設(shè)計(jì)方法與傳統(tǒng)方法對(duì)比過程。
2.3實(shí)驗(yàn)結(jié)果分析
通過上述實(shí)驗(yàn)結(jié)果可知,在數(shù)據(jù)傳輸速度變化的過程中,不同的數(shù)據(jù)傳輸速度對(duì)資源傳輸?shù)恼_性影響較小。但通過方法對(duì)比可以看出,文中設(shè)計(jì)方法的誤碼率低于其他兩種傳輸方法,且傳輸時(shí)延相較于此兩種方法的傳輸時(shí)延較短。通過研究可知,正確傳輸概率與傳輸平均時(shí)延的關(guān)鍵影響因素在于教學(xué)資源平臺(tái)選用的網(wǎng)絡(luò)構(gòu)架。由上述實(shí)驗(yàn)結(jié)果可知,在教學(xué)資源平臺(tái)的設(shè)計(jì)過程中增加混合P2P網(wǎng)絡(luò)可提升資源數(shù)據(jù)的傳輸能力。
三、結(jié)束語
在此次采用混合P2P網(wǎng)絡(luò)技術(shù)的高職院校教學(xué)資原平臺(tái)建設(shè)中還存在相應(yīng)的缺陷與問題有待進(jìn)一步的解決,還需要更高的技術(shù)實(shí)現(xiàn)教學(xué)資源平臺(tái)的發(fā)展。因?yàn)楦呗氃盒=虒W(xué)資源平臺(tái)的建設(shè)和發(fā)展不是一件一勞永逸的事,需要長(zhǎng)時(shí)間的應(yīng)用測(cè)試與研究,證實(shí)資源平臺(tái)使用的科學(xué)性。
所以,資源平臺(tái)的優(yōu)化問題是一個(gè)有待考慮的問題,且由于時(shí)間與技術(shù)等方面的限制,目前教學(xué)資源平臺(tái)在功能上并沒有達(dá)到預(yù)期的設(shè)想和功能,許多應(yīng)用環(huán)節(jié)需要進(jìn)一步的研究與開發(fā)。
參? 考? 文? 獻(xiàn)
[1]張亞新.信息化時(shí)代數(shù)據(jù)庫課程建設(shè)教學(xué)改革探索[J].產(chǎn)業(yè)與科技論壇,2020,19(01):165-166.
[2]徐駿.本科教學(xué)基本狀態(tài)數(shù)據(jù)庫建設(shè)的思考與實(shí)踐[J].電腦知識(shí)與技術(shù),2019,15(20):176-177.
[3]王開宇.高校教學(xué)資源數(shù)據(jù)庫系統(tǒng)的共建共享建設(shè)研究[J].信息技術(shù)與信息化,2018(05):215-217.
[4]朱聃,何燕鋒,劉志軍.移動(dòng)混合型對(duì)等網(wǎng)絡(luò)P2P流媒體系統(tǒng)[J].現(xiàn)代信息科技,2020,4(09):89-90+93.
[5]楊毓茹,鄭佳春,彭新哲.CDN-P2P混合結(jié)構(gòu)中的協(xié)同過濾推薦算法[J].莆田學(xué)院學(xué)報(bào), 2020,27(02):82-88.
[6] 嚴(yán)惠,鄧小龍,孔德文.混合P2P模式下雙服務(wù)器通訊研究與驗(yàn)證[J].電子器件, 2019,42(06): 1578-1582.
[7]龍軍,王宇樓.P2P流媒體網(wǎng)絡(luò)的關(guān)鍵節(jié)點(diǎn)識(shí)別算法[J].計(jì)算機(jī)工程與科學(xué),2019,41(01):56-64.
[8]李曉紅 包頭醫(yī)學(xué)院專題特色數(shù)據(jù)庫建設(shè)實(shí)踐與研究[J].包頭醫(yī)學(xué)院學(xué)報(bào),2019,35(12):103-104+115.